Ghimarujan is a Rural village located in Helem, Biswanath, Assam.
The total population of Ghimarujan is 766.
Ghimarujan village comprises 166 households.
The literacy rate in Ghimarujan is 83.3%. Among the literate population of 545, there are 291 literate males and 254 literate females.
In Ghimarujan, there are 392 males and 374 females, with a sex ratio of 954 females per 1000 males.
There are 112 children (14.6% of population), comprising 64 boys and 48 girls.
The total number of workers in Ghimarujan is 338, with 203 main workers and 135 marginal workers.
In Ghimarujan, there are 280 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(146 males, 134 females) and 5 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(4 males, 1 females).
Ghimarujan is located in Assam state, Biswanath district, and falls under Helem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 287086 and LGD code is 287086.
